
Quebec air ambulance company pays homage to four victims of helicopter crash
MONTREAL — The company that operated an air ambulance that crashed on Quebec’s North Shore on June 20 is honouring the four victims who perished.
Airmedic says three of its crew members died as heroes, along with an American patient.
Four crew members and the patient were aboard the Airmedic helicopter when it went down in a remote area north of Natashquan, about 1,000 kilometres northeast of Montreal.
The company described the patient as a quiet woman, entirely devoted to her family.
